Living and working in Koorda
Koorda is a town in the north eastern Wheatbelt region of Western Australia, approximately 236 kilometres east of Perth and 43 kilometres north of Wyalkatchem at the northeastern end of the Cowcowing Lakes. It is the main town in the Shire of Koorda.
